资源简介:
The escalating prevalence of misleading healthcare advertising, significantly amplified by Artificial Intelligence in cyberspace, poses profound legal disruptions within Indonesia. This study examines how Artificial Intelligence contributes to the proliferation of disinformation and misinformation in health advertisements and critically analyses the inherent limitations of current Indonesian regulatory frameworks. Our findings reveal Artificial Intelligence's predominant use in generating deepfake representations of public figures, illicitly enhancing product credibility and circumventing verification. Such practices fundamentally breach principles of accountability and transparency, complicating regulatory enforcement, especially given the transnational nature of foreign disinformation agencies. Programmatic advertising schemes further erode media editorial oversight, facilitating the deceptive infiltration of fabricated, misleading advertisements that bypass traditional controls. Despite existing enforcement measures by the Food and Drug Administration of the Republic of Indonesia (BPOM) and the Indonesian Press Council, responses remain largely reactive. Indonesian regulations are critically hampered by a lack of harmonization across sectoral laws, insufficient oversight of Artificial Intelligence in content distribution, and limited internet intermediary responsibility under safe harbor policies. A significant deficit in intermediary transparency and accountability regarding algorithmic operations further exacerbates these regulatory gaps. Drawing from international precedents, this research suggests Indonesia could adopt strategies emphasizing enhanced transparency and accountability, leveraging Artificial Intelligence for disinformation detection, imposing greater intermediary liability, fostering multi-stakeholder regulatory models, and robustly strengthening public digital literacy. These comprehensive legal and policy strategies are imperative for mitigating misinformation risks and bolstering public communication integrity in healthcare.
